Harnessing the Power of Structured Data to Enhance Your GMB Profile Visibility
Implementing structured data markup, such as Schema.org annotations, can significantly improve how your business information appears in search results. For instance, adding LocalBusiness schema helps Google understand your business type, services, and location more precisely, enabling rich snippets that attract clicks and improve your local pack rankings. This technical layer acts as a bridge between your GMB profile and search engine algorithms, making your listing more discoverable and contextually relevant.
According to Google’s SEO starter guide, proper markup can influence how your listing appears, especially in competitive local markets. For example, including detailed service schemas can highlight specific offerings, making your profile stand out against competitors who overlook this advanced tactic. This is particularly effective in service-based industries where specialized offerings or seasonal promotions can be emphasized through structured data.
Integrating Voice Search Optimization into GMB Strategies for Future-Proof Local SEO
With the rapid increase in voice searches, optimizing your GMB profile for voice command queries is essential. This involves tailoring content to match natural language questions consumers are likely to ask, such as “Where can I find a reputable plumber near me?” or “What are the store hours for [Business Name]?”. Employing conversational keywords and FAQs on your website, linked to your GMB profile, enhances the chances of voice assistants retrieving your business in relevant voice search results.
Research by BrightLocal indicates that 58% of consumers have used voice search to find local business information, underscoring its importance. Incorporate long-tail keywords naturally into your GMB posts and descriptions to align with voice search patterns, and consider creating dedicated FAQ sections that address common voice queries for your industry.

How Can Hyper-Localized Content Strategies Revolutionize Your GMB Presence?
Moving beyond generic descriptions, hyper-localized content tailors your messaging to specific neighborhoods, communities, or even individual landmarks. This approach involves creating location-specific posts, showcasing local events, and participating in community initiatives. Incorporating local slang, culturally relevant references, and localized keywords enhances relevance and engagement. For instance, a bakery might feature posts about participating in a nearby farmers’ market or sponsoring a local charity, thereby strengthening community ties and boosting local search visibility.
